A gift for Liwanag: Ben&Ben premieres “The Traveller Across Dimensions” concert film online

GabrielBy GabrielDecember 17, 2025No Comments4 Mins Read
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

The award-winning band closes 2025 with a year-end celebration of music, storytelling, and community, giving fans a front-row experience from anywhere in the world

One year after translating their award-winning 2025 concept into a sold-out spectacle at the SM Mall of Asia Arena, Ben&Ben invites fans into the luminous universe of Liwanag through The Traveller Across Dimensions: The Concert Film. 

The special full-length film, created in collaboration with LunchBox Productions, will premiere on YouTube on December 14, 2025, giving audiences across the globe the rare opportunity to relive the concert experience in full, free of charge.

Ben&Ben explains: “We really wanted all our listeners to get to enjoy this concert that we poured our hearts and souls into, so we deliberately chose to make this as accessible as possible by putting it up on YouTube. We thought it would also be a nice way to bring families together for the holidays, sharing with each other the magic and joy of our concert from the comfort of their homes.”

Billed as a “multiverse of music and emotion,” the original TTAD concert blurred the boundaries between concert, animation, and theater. Staged late last year, the arena show received widespread acclaim for its storytelling, emotional depth, and technical execution, setting a new benchmark for multimedia concerts in the Philippines. The cinematic retelling offers both a retrospective and a revelation for fans who want to relive that night in the arena and for those  who will be seeing it for the first time. 

“When we first conceptualized the concert and saw all the work that had to be put into it, we knew we wanted to exert an equal amount of effort to document it all. It represented many firsts for us: our first major concert at the MOA Arena, our first time performing that many songs, and our first time attempting to record a show of that scale,” Ben&Ben shares. “With all the work we put into each second of it, we knew a well-made concert film also needed a lot of work and enough time for it to be ready for public release. So that, along with us continuing to tour The Traveller Across Dimensions throughout the year, we ultimately decided to release the film as a first anniversary special offering.”

According to the nine-piece band, the concert film was conceived as a heartfelt ‘thank you’ to their fans, fondly called Liwanag. The film’s free release emphasizes Ben&Ben’s ongoing commitment to accessibility and community. 

“This year has been just so challenging for so many of us,” Ben&Ben says. “But despite these challenges, we’ve felt so much love and support from all of our Liwanag, from them constantly listening to our music to still showing up and attending our live shows. As the year ends, we wanted to give back by simply letting people enjoy this show, no strings attached, no paywall.”

While the live concert captivated the crowd with its scale and immediacy, the film version provides a more intimate encounter, allowing audiences to discern subtle details, symbolisms, and emotional arcs that may have been missed in the live setting. 

In the weeks leading to the release of The Traveller Across Dimensions: The Concert Film, Ben&Ben earned Album of the Year honors at the Awit Awards 2025, the country’s version of the Grammys. Soon after, fans were treated to a surprise first look at the concert trailer during The Traveller Across Dimensions: An Immersive Storytelling Experience. The trailer eventually premiered on social media channels on December 3, 2025, a day after the official announcement about the concert film was shared online.
